Summary: | The present invention is to provide a lithium secondary battery separator with excellent adhesive strength and air permeability, the lithium secondary battery separator comprising: a porous polymer substrate; and a porous coating layer containing inorganic particles and a binder, wherein when the binder is prepared as a binder specimen with a thickness of 0.4 mm by pressurization at 190°C, the binder specimen comprises a first binder having a tan δ peak at 15-27.6°C and a second binder having a tan δ peak at 8-20.2°C, as measured by dynamic mechanical analysis (DMA). |
